In our Nation, even convicted felons can serve in Congress. In fact, “The House of Representative has an internal rule that any member who is convicted of an offense that could result in two or more years’ imprisonment cannot vote or participate in committee activities. However, the privileges of such member can be restored if he or she is reelected to Congress. The Senate does not have a similar rule. Both the Democratic and Republican parties can censure their own members in the House and Senate, including removing them from committees, as they see fit.” (voanews.com; March 21, 2023.) Expulsion from Congress is like “taking the nuclear option”. Few have ever been expelled, more from the Senate than from the House.
